Kira & Bob Lorsch Chair 55th Thalians Gala at Playboy Mansion Honoring Hugh Hefner

Thalians Mental Health and UCLA's Operation Mend to Benefit


LOS ANGELES, CA--(Marketwire - November 9, 2010) -  Robert H. "Bob" Lorsch and wife Kira Reed Lorsch, through the Robert H. Lorsch Family Foundation Trust and The RHL Group, will chair the 55th Annual Thalians Gala to be held on April 30th, 2011 at the Playboy Mansion in Los Angeles. The event will honor Hugh M. Hefner for a lifetime of philanthropy coinciding with the celebration of his 85th Birthday. Proceeds will go to The Thalians in support of Operation Mend at the UCLA Health System Medical Center. Dr. Timothy Miller, Chief of Plastic Surgery at UCLA and Executive Director of Operation Mend, will also receive a special award for his facial reconstruction of severely injured veterans.

The night's entertainment will feature comedians including "Roastmaster General" Jeffrey Ross and surprise musical guests. Rodney "Darkchild" Jerkins, credited with producing Lady Gaga, Destiny's Child, Janet Jackson and many others, is contributing his services as Musical Director. Corporate Sponsor MMRGlobal (MMRF) will launch its www.mybluebutton.org program as previously announced by the company on October 26th. A lifetime MyMedicalRecords Personal Health Record account will also be given to patients of Operation Mend.

According to Dr. Timothy Miller, "Since we launched Operation Mend in October 2007, we have operated on nearly 40 patients, most of them severely injured by roadside explosives while serving in the Middle East. Among the most profound effects we see as they undergo many surgeries are the changes in their personalities. We are expanding the program's services to include advanced treatment for traumatic brain injury, and, in collaboration with the United States Army Institute of Surgical Research, we are participating in a project called Save a Life to prevent suicide and improve soldiers' overall psychological health and functioning."

The Thalians was founded in 1955 by a group of young actors and allied professionals from the film industry who wanted to give back some of their blessings to the community. Over the past 55 years, the group, long led by President Debbie Reynolds and Board Chair Ruta Lee, has raised over $30 million in support of Mental Health programs for diseases including Autism, Alzheimer's, Bi-Polar Disorder, Schizophrenia, Phobias, Post Traumatic Stress, Depression and Addictions.

Past honorees of The Thalians have included in order of award: Peter Ustinov, Jane Wyman, Jimmy Durante, Robert Preston, Harold Lloyd, Mary Martin, Lana Turner, Ed Sullivan, Shirley MacLaine, Busby Berkeley, June Haver, Gene Kelly, Fred MacMurray, Sammy Davis, Ann-Margret, Lucille Ball, Carol Burnett, Debbie Reynolds, Van Johnson, Bing Crosby, Ann Miller, Bob Hope, Angela Lansbury, Dorothy Lamour, James Stewart, Rita Hayworth, Whoopi Goldberg, Count Basie, Liza Minnelli, Jack Lemmon, Donald O'Connor, Lena Horne, Kenny Rogers, Carol Channing, Sally Field, Ruta Lee, Mary Tyler Moore, Phyllis Diller, Burt Bacharach, Red Buttons, Sir Roger Moore, Clint Eastwood and Mickey Rooney.

About The Thalians and Operation Mend

The Thalians, led by President Debbie Reynolds and Board Chair Ruta Lee, have raised over $30 million in support of Mental Health programs for pediatrics through geriatrics for diseases including: Autism, Alzheimer's, Bi-Polar Disorder, Schizophrenia, Phobias, Post Traumatic Stress, Depression and Addictions. The annual Gala selects its honorees for their contributions to the entertainment industry and their philanthropic endeavors. The Mr./Ms. Wonderful award was personally created and designed for The Thalians by Walt Disney himself and has become a most sought after collector's item. The Thalians cause is Mental Illness, which affects more people than all other diseases combined. Learn more at http://www.thethalians.org.

Operation Mend is a unique partnership between Ronald Reagan UCLA Medical Center, Brooke Army Medical Center in San Antonio, Texas and the V.A. Greater Los Angeles Healthcare System. It has been established to help treat U.S. military personnel wounded during service in Iraq and Afghanistan. Military veteran Timothy A. Miller, Chief of the Division of Plastic and Reconstructive Surgery at UCLA, leads the surgeries. The Thalians are proud to present him with a special Medical award at the Gala for his dedication to Healing America's Veterans Body and Mind.
